I've been a Seiko enthusiast for many years, and it's been a long time since I've treated myself to a beautiful watch from our Japanese friends. I own several Divers watches from the brand, but none with a GMT function. So when I saw the SPB381 and 383 released a while ago, I almost succumbed... But since I already own watches with green and black dials, reason won out over passion! Of course, when this limited blue edition came out this year, I fell for it! Indeed, this "Blue Wave" dial is magnificent, and the waves remind us of Hokusai's. The texture and relief of the dial change the color of this blue, going from turquoise to a deep blue, reminiscent of the colors of the ocean. At times, you can't even see these waves, which makes the watch change; it's simply beautiful. As you can see, I am the proud owner of the SPB509. Regarding the technical aspects, I won't dwell on them, but the new bracelet with Slide Adjuster is truly a beautiful innovation and allows for precise adjustment on all wrists. We can appreciate the polished/brushed finish that Seiko has mastered, as well as the beautiful ceramic bezel, which reinforces the watch's quality. I recognize, through this beauty, the strength that Seiko had, which has attracted many watch enthusiasts, to offer watches with an almost unbeatable RQP. Unfortunately, it must be said that prices have skyrocketed lately, hence my Seiko pause, but for the moment, I find this Diver offers a lot, and I'm delighted with my purchase! For those who want a dive watch with a GMT function, I can only recommend it.
